dc.description.abstract"...Their attitude has been improved also by Congressional recognition in the enactment of Public Law 437, 81st Congress, of the principle of payment of damages for intangible losses suffered by the Indian people and by recognition, in the enactment of Public Law 870, 81st Congress, of the right of Tribes to negotiate with the Government for damages covering both their tangible and intangible losses...Provisions include 4 per cent interest for any sum set aside."en_US
